首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用yfinance获取错误的卷

(也称为证券)是指在使用yfinance库进行金融数据获取时,无法正确获取到特定证券的数据的问题。

yfinance是一个用于获取和处理Yahoo Finance数据的Python库。它允许开发人员通过使用简单的代码来访问金融市场的历史数据、股票报价、分红信息等。

如果在使用yfinance获取卷时出现错误,可能是以下原因之一:

  1. 证券代码错误:确保输入的证券代码是正确的。证券代码一般由一些字母和数字组成,用来唯一标识某个证券。不同的证券市场有不同的命名规则和代码格式。
  2. 数据不可用:某些证券的数据可能在Yahoo Finance上不可用。这可能是因为数据提供者限制了对特定证券数据的访问,或者Yahoo Finance没有涵盖到该证券。
  3. 服务器访问问题:有时,由于服务器问题或网络连接问题,无法成功访问yfinance的服务器。在这种情况下,可以尝试稍后重新运行代码。

为解决这个问题,可以采取以下步骤:

  1. 检查证券代码:确保输入的证券代码是正确的,可以通过访问官方证券交易所或金融数据提供商的网站来获取正确的证券代码。
  2. 尝试其他数据源:除了yfinance,还有许多其他金融数据提供商可供选择。可以尝试使用其他数据提供商的API来获取数据,例如Alpha Vantage、Quandl等。
  3. 查找帮助文档和社区支持:yfinance有详细的文档和一个活跃的开发者社区。可以查阅yfinance的官方文档,或在相关的开发者社区或论坛上寻求帮助。

在腾讯云的产品生态中,与金融数据和云计算相关的产品有:

  1. 弹性MapReduce(EMR):是一种海量数据处理和分析服务,适用于金融行业中的大数据分析和处理需求。详情请参考:腾讯云EMR产品介绍
  2. 对象存储(COS):是腾讯云提供的一种低成本、高可靠、可扩展的云存储服务,适用于金融数据的长期存储和备份。详情请参考:腾讯云COS产品介绍
  3. 人工智能(AI):腾讯云提供了一系列人工智能相关的产品和服务,包括自然语言处理、图像识别、机器学习等,可应用于金融数据分析和预测等场景。详情请参考:腾讯云人工智能产品介绍

需要注意的是,以上产品仅作为示例,具体的产品选择应根据实际需求和业务场景进行评估。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

window32api_win32api与硬件设备

作者:浪子花梦,一个有趣的程序员 ~ . Win32API 相关文章如下: Win32利用CreateEvent 实现简单的 —— 线程同步 Win32消息处理机制与窗口制作 Win32远程线程注入 .dll 文件 Win32删除目录下的所有文件 —— 递归遍历 (一)Win32服务程序编写 —— 使用SC命令创建与删除 (二)Win32服务程序编写 —— 使用命令行参数创建与删除 Win32使用快照、psapi.dll、wtsapi32.dll、ntdll.dll 四种方式实现 —— 枚举进程 (一)Win32进程通信 —— 自定义消息实现 (二)Win32进程通信 —— 内存映射文件 (三)Win32进程通信 —— 数据复制消息 (四)Win32进程通信 —— 剪贴板的使用 (五)Win32进程通信 —— 匿名管道 (六)Win32进程通信 —— 邮槽的使用

01

windows错误处理

在调用windows API时函数会首先对我们传入的参数进行校验,然后执行,如果出现什么情况导致函数执行出错,有的函数可以通过返回值来判断函数是否出错,比如对于返回句柄的函数如果返回NULL 或者INVALID_HANDLE_VALUE,则函数出错,对于返回指针的函数来说如果返回NULL则函数出错,但是对于有的函数从返回值来看根本不知道是否成功,或者为什么失败,对此windows提供了一大堆的错误码,用于标识API函数是否出错以及出错原因。 在windows中为每个线程准备了一个存储区,专门用来存储当前API执行的错误码,想要获取这个错误码可以通过函数GetLastError。在这需要注意的是当前API执行返回的错误码会覆盖之前API返回的错误码,所以在调用API结束后需要立马调用GetLastError来获取该函数返回的错误码。但是windows中的错误码实在太多,有的时候错误码并不直观,windows为每个错误码都关联了一个错误信息的文本,想要通过错误码获取对应的文本信息,可以通过函数FormatMessage来获取。 下面是一个具体的例子:

02
领券